Analysis
Malta recorded 1.9 % change on previous year for population ages 65-69, male, annual growth rate in 2025.
The figure is down 48.1% on the previous year and up 27.2% over ten years.
Over the whole period, population ages 65-69, male, annual growth rate in Malta peaked at 14.15 % change on previous year in 2012 and was at its lowest, -3.51 % change on previous year, in 2007.
Malta ranks 166th of 218 countries on this measure, in the bottom quarter.
The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ated
The year-on-year percentage change in Population ages 65-69, male. Computed from consecutive annual observations; years either side of a gap are skipped rather than bridged.
Computed from
- Population ages 65-69, male World Bank staff estimates using the World Bank's total population and age/sex distributions of the United Nations Population Division's World Population Prospects
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
